You can also add it to your strength workouts to build strength in the arms, chest ... WebJul 18, 2024 · The Bottom Line on Dynamic vs. Static Stretching. Dynamic stretching is active; stretching your muscles while moving strengthens them at the same time and is best used as a warm-up. Static stretching is stationary and helps lengthen and relax your muscles, making it ideal for a cooldown. Advertisement. Web8. Inchworm. Stand with your feet shoulder-width apart. Fold forwards at the hips and place your hands on the ground. Walk your hands out until you are in a high plank—hands under shoulders and body in a straight line from head to hips to heels. Walk your feet towards your hands, until they're under your hips.
